04 07 2023
加密和解密是信息安全领域中非常重要的概念。在加密过程中,我们将明文(未经加密的消息)转换为密文(加密后的消息),以确保只有授权方能够理解和解读该消息。解密则是将密文还原为明文的过程。下面我将简要介绍一些加密和解密的方法。 1. 对称加密算法: 对称加密算法使用相同的密钥进行加密和解密。常见的对称加密算法有DES、3DES、AES等。加密过程中,明文和密钥通过一定的变换产生密文。解密时,使用相同的密钥对密文进行逆变换还原为明文。对称加密算法的优点是速度快,但密钥需要安全地传输和存储。 2. 非对称加密算法: 非对称加密算法使用一对密钥,分别称为公钥和私钥。公钥用于加密消息,私钥用于解密消息。常见的非对称加密算法有RSA、DSA、ECC等。加密过程中,使用公钥加密的消息只能使用私钥解密,而使用私钥加密的消息只能使用公钥解密。非对称加密算法的优点是安全性高,但速度较慢。 3. 哈希算法: 哈希算法是将任意长度的消息经过哈希函数处理,生成一个固定长度的哈希值。常见的哈希算法有MD5、SHA-1、SHA-256等。哈希算法通常用于验证消息的完整性和一致性,不可逆性。在加密中,可以使用哈希算法对密码进行处理,增加安全性。 加密和解密涉及到复杂的数学运算和算法,如果您想要更深入了解,可以查阅相关的资料和文献。此外,在实际应用中,还需要考虑密钥管理、安全传输等问题,以确保加密系统的安全性。
延伸阅读
    传承工匠精神 扛起时代担当 演讲稿800字
    学生是否应该学习人工智能?
    文化艺术欣赏指南:探索不同领域的艺术之美
    如何进行软件架构优化和系统性能监测?
    jquery给class为wpglobus_flag_en的父级标签追加id